Understanding the Manaus Real Estate Market

Manaus, the capital city of the state of Amazonas in Brazil, is a bustling metropolis with a rich cultural heritage and a thriving real estate market. It’s essential to understand the local market dynamics before diving in. For instance, the city’s real estate market has been on an upward trend, with property prices increasing by 3.5% in the last year. 📈

Setting a Realistic Budget

First things first, you need to set a realistic budget. This should include not only the purchase price but also additional costs such as property taxes, home insurance, and maintenance costs. In Manaus, the average price per square meter for an apartment in the city center is around R$4,500. 💰

Choosing the Right Location

Location is key when buying a home. Manaus offers a variety of neighborhoods, each with its unique charm and amenities. For instance, Adrianópolis is known for its upscale apartments and vibrant nightlife, while Ponta Negra offers a more tranquil environment with stunning views of the Rio Negro. 🏞️

Securing a Mortgage

As a first-time home buyer in Brazil, you may be eligible for the government’s “Minha Casa Minha Vida” program, which offers low-interest mortgages to low and middle-income families. It’s worth exploring this option as it could significantly reduce your monthly payments. 🏦

FAQs

  • Is it safe to buy property in Manaus? Yes, it is generally safe to buy property in Manaus. However, like any major city, it’s important to do your research and work with a reputable real estate agent.
  • What is the average cost of a home in Manaus? The average cost of a home in Manaus can vary greatly depending on the location and size of the property. On average, you can expect to pay around R$4,500 per square meter in the city center.
  • Can foreigners buy property in Brazil? Yes, foreigners can buy property in Brazil. However, there may be additional legal requirements, so it’s recommended to work with a local real estate agent or lawyer.
